Functions for Boundary Elements
List of members: | |
---|---|
BE_n() | normal with respect to a boundary element |
BEarea() | area of a boundary element |
BEbinA() | Alias step function for boundary elements |
BEcham() | Chamber of a boundary element |
BEcluster() | Cluster ID of a boundary element |
BEgauss() | BE local Gaussian curvature |
BEhasCurv() | 1 if curvature computation is successful |
BEident() | IDENT of a boundary element |
BEincidence() | number of incidental edges of a node point |
BEindA() | Alias index of boundary element |
BEisCloseToPC() | Check if boundary element if close to pointcloud |
BEisOnEdge() | 1 if boundary node belongs to an edge |
BElayer() | Layer of a boundary element |
BEmap() | Fetch result of mapping onto boundary element |
BEmaxCurv() | BE local maximum curvature |
BEminCurv() | BE local minimum curvature |
BEmon() | BE monitor item results |
BEmonApprox() | BE monitor item results (experimental!) |
BEpos() | midpoint, minimum or maximum position of a boundary element |
BEprincipalCurvatureEdge1() | first edge of principal curvature computation |
BEprincipalCurvatureEdge2() | second edge of principal curvature computation |
BEprincipalCurvatureEdge3() | third edge of principal curvature computation |
BEprincipalCurvatureEdge4() | fourth edge of principal curvature computation |
BEprincipalCurvatureNormal() | normal for principal curvature computation |
BErand() | Random position on random BE of a given alias |
BEshape() | shape of a boundary element |
BEsum() | summation over values given on boundary elements |
BEsymmetryface() | Symmetryface of a boundary element |
